Using a Consultant to prepare an IT and eBusiness Improvement Plan.

Virtually all companies are making increasing use of computers, the Internet, telephones and similar technologies. While most managers realise that their businesses could benefit from a planned and organised approach to using such technologies, many are not sure how best to adopt such an approach. One solution is to work with an independent, expert, consultant to: -

  • Review the business's information and transaction processing needs
  • Audit the existing IT facilities, procedures and skills.
  • Draw up an improvement plan.

This guide is designed to help you select and work with such a consultant.
